How did you prepare for the interview?

SDN, practicing answers with family and pre-med advisor, talking out loud in my room and my car (seriously...it really helps to hear yourself out loud)

What impressed you positively?

The facilities were awesome, they definitely make it a good day for you.

What impressed you negatively?

The interviews were at the end of the day, so I was tired by the most important part - but it was also good because there was plenty of time to relax.

What did you wish you had known ahead of time?

That the interviews would be so relaxed. The student interview was really great - she was really just interested in getting to know me. The faculty interview was also laid back.
